India closes in on Oman trade deal as Mideast ties strengthen

IndiaTimes Tuesday, 27 February 2024
India and Oman are close to concluding talks on a trade deal. Oman's strategic location near the Strait of Hormuz makes it crucial for India. Both countries want better access for a wide range of goods and services. Trade talks have been expedited recently. Oman is India’s third-largest trade partner among the GCC nations.
